This multi-center extended investigation continues to collect supportive and confirmatory safety and effectiveness of data regarding the Zenith ® TX2™ TAA Endovascular Graft in elective treatment of patients with descending thoracic aortic aneurysms (DTAA).

We are enrolling patients in the extended investigation/continued access arm of the trial, as well as conducting a 5-year follow-up of the patients enrolled in the pivotal arm of the trial.

This trial is sponsored by Cook, Inc.

The objective of the study is to evaluate the safety and efficacy of the Valiant Thoracic Stent Graft System in the treatment of patients with a Descending Thoracic Aneurysm of degenerative etiology that are candidates for endovascular repair.

The study is open to enrollment.

The trial is sponsored by Medtronic Vascular
